Free Food Pantry Open to the Community

In partnership with God's Pantry, we are distributing free grocery items every month on a first come, first served basis. We believe that having access to food is important for good health, and we want you to be healthy! Everyone is welcome – no appointment needed.

Check our calendar or contact us for information on our next food pantry.

Our Services

We offer many different services to the public. Stop by our food pantry, or use our wi-fi for your telehealth visits. You can also schedule a visit for health plan member services. You can schedule an appointment for services with a representative by calling us at 1.562.651.6060.

Rewards

Got Rewards

My Rewards for a Healthy Life is a program where you can earn rewards for participating in a variety of health education classes at our Community Resource Centers. After participating in six health education classes, you are eligible for a premium gift.
